5 Week Outcry- Prayer and Fasting- Virtual


We are excited to announce that our 2026, 5-week Fasting & Prayer journey, titled “The Outcry,” is about to begin! Over these five weeks, we’ll unite our hearts in focused prayer, lifting up the following areas:

Week 1: Fear → Trust

  • Scripture: 2 Timothy 1:7 or Isaiah 41:10

  • Focus: God has not given you fear

  • Prayer: Release anxiety, receive peace

Week 2: Unforgiveness → Freedom

  • Scripture: Ephesians 4:31–32

  • Focus: Forgiveness frees you

  • Prayer: Name and release people/situations

Week 3: Trauma/Paralysis → Movement

  • Scripture: Psalm 147:3

  • Focus: God heals what has kept you stuck

  • Prayer: Break stagnation, invite restoration

Week 4: Grief → Healing

  • Scripture: Matthew 5:4

  • Focus: God meets you in sorrow

  • Prayer: Comfort, strength, and peace

Week 5: Letting Go → Surrender

  • Scripture: Proverbs 3:5–6

  • Focus: Release control, trust God’s direction

  • Prayer: Surrender burdens, receive clarity.

    This is an opportunity to draw nearer to God, support one another, and cover our families and futures in prayer.

We’ll come together during our regular weekly prayer calls—Tuesdays from 6:30 to 7:00 pm and Thursdays from 7:00 to 7:30 am, with worship music beginning 15 minutes beforehand to prepare our hearts. While the format will remain the same, each call will align with that week’s specific focus.

Outside of these gatherings, you’re encouraged to structure your own prayer times throughout the week in a way that best fits your schedule. Fasting is optional, and the type of fast is entirely up to you.
